Chain Reaction - Simone Elkeles Okay, so yes, this book was very predictable, very similar to Perfect Chemistry and Rules of Attraction, and at times cheesy--but I didn't care because I can't get enough of the Fuentes brothers! Simone Elkeles' writing is addictive, and I couldn't put this book down!This is the story of the youngest Fuentes brother, Luis, who is now a senior in high school. Like in Perfect Chemistry and Rules of Attraction, romance is at its core. I mentioned in another review that I really enjoy alternating perspectives, and this book switches between Luis and Nikki's points of view, like how Perfect Chemistry switched between Brittany and Alex and Rules of Attraction switched between Kiara and Carlos. I just love seeing both sides of the story of a romance, and this book delivered, even though at times I was skeptical about how realistic Luis's thoughts were. The best part of this book, for me, were the appearances of Alex and Brittany because their relationship was my favorite (Perfect Chemistry still remains my favorite of these books and counts as one of my all-time favorite books) and I loved seeing how they were still so very much in love. If you were hoping that this book would be a completely new and original story, then you will be disappointed because it's basically the same story as the first two books. As I mentioned earlier, though, I personally didn't care at all because I ate up the previous books and just wanted more of the Fuentes brothers. These books are "comfort reads" for me and I will definitely be rereading them. I can't wait to see what other stories Simone Elkeles has in store for us in the future!
